Unleash Your Inner Foodie at Poppas Kitchen
Our menu offers a diverse array of delicious dishes. Here at Poppas Kitchen, we pride ourselves on our flavorful dishes and our intentional service. But don’t just take our word for it! Come check it out for yourself and see our customer reviews.
We are located at 2207 E Ledbetter Dr b, Dallas, TX 75216, USA. Excited to serve you great food with a smile :)
https://zingmyorder.com/restaurants/poppas-kitchen-2207-e-ledbetter-dr-b-dallas-tx-75216-usa